Quarter-Finals Round 4: Benetton TV - Sidigas AV 69-59

Date: May 25, 2011
Benetton toppled Air Avellino in Treviso and clinched the semifinal spot. The game was mostly controlled by Benetton Treviso. Air Avellino was better in second period 16-14. But it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. Benetton Treviso dominated down low during the game scoring 48 of its points in the paint compared to Air Avellino's 26. They outrebounded Air Avellino 46-30 including a 33-22 advantage in defensive rebounds. The winners were led by Lithuanian center Donatas Motiejunas (213-90, agency: Interperformances) who scored that evening 20 points and 5 rebounds and swingman Alessandro Gentile (198-92) supported him with 14 points and 5 rebounds. Even a double-double of 10 points and 11 rebounds by American forward Linton Johnson (203-80, college: Tulane, agency: Priority Sports) did not help to save the game for Air Avellino. American-Spanish guard Taquan Dean (193-83, college: Louisville, agency: Lanshire Group) added 18 points for lost side.
